I'm surprised at the gushing reviews; I didn't think this one was that good. It's a decent story, and it's well done, with good performances and all. I particularly liked Jeanette Nolan as Granny Hart-- just delicious. But the story lacks any kind of twist ending; indeed, by the time we reach the climax, it's pretty anticlimactic. Part of the problem is that the story is rather padded to fill the hour-long format. The whole thing would've been tighter and better if it ended after Billy-Ben (or whatever his name was) shoots the leopard, finds the ring, and realizes he's just actually killed Jess-Belle. Let the story be that she really is dead and gone at that point, the end. Everything that happens after that in the story is really pretty superfluous.
